org.junitpioneer.jupiter.params.package-info Maven / Gradle / Ivy
The newest version!
/**
* Several extensions for working with {@code ParameterizedTest}s.
*
* Disable {@code @ParameterizedTest} executions based on conditions. Check out the following types for details:
*
* - {@link org.junitpioneer.jupiter.params.DisableIfDisplayName}
* - {@link org.junitpioneer.jupiter.params.DisableIfAllArguments}
* - {@link org.junitpioneer.jupiter.params.DisableIfAnyArgument}
* - {@link org.junitpioneer.jupiter.params.DisableIfArgument}
*
*
* Argument providers for a range of numbers. Check out the following types for details on providing values for
* parameterized tests:
*
*
* - {@link org.junitpioneer.jupiter.params.ByteRangeSource}
* - {@link org.junitpioneer.jupiter.params.ShortRangeSource}
* - {@link org.junitpioneer.jupiter.params.IntRangeSource}
* - {@link org.junitpioneer.jupiter.params.LongRangeSource}
* - {@link org.junitpioneer.jupiter.params.FloatRangeSource}
* - {@link org.junitpioneer.jupiter.params.DoubleRangeSource}
*
*
* Argument aggregator for simple use cases. Check out the following type for details:
*
*
* - {@link org.junitpioneer.jupiter.params.Aggregate}
*
*/
package org.junitpioneer.jupiter.params;